Spontaneous compactification of d = 11 supergravity due to Rarita-Schwinger fields

A characteristic feature of all the spontaneous compactification mechanisms so far proposed has been the consideration of only the boson sector of the theories being compactified, i.e., the vacuum values of the Fermi fields were assumed to be zero. Thus, in d = 11 supergravity one uses the Freund-Rubin mechanism of compactification due to antisymmetric tensor fields F/sub MNPQ/. This mechanism yielded in particular compactifications onto the round, squashed, and squashed with torsion seven-dimensional spheres. In the present paper, the Freund-Rubin mechanism is generalized to nonvanishing vacuum values of a Rarita-Schwinger field and is used to obtain a new solution of d = 11 supergravity
